While there was no announcement of “Warcraft IV” or mention of any other major Warcraft releases in the future, Stilwell said that the reaction they got from “Reforged” at Blizzcon is a clear sign of what players want.With Reforged I've enjoyed dipping back into the world of Warcraft 3, its real-time strategy gameplay eternally rewarding. “So we’re looking for the next generation of modders and creations that should come from this.” “’Warcraft III’ players built new genres with the tools in the original games– tower defense, MOBA, it came from them,” Stilwell said. Stilwell added that they had hired some of the original Warcraft III modders to get a perspective from the community and improve the custom tools for a modern modding scene. Sousa added that they’re looking at a fan response to determine changes to their newly redesigned UI and environmental effects so the elements that worried fans could be fixed before release. “A big part of the reveal at Blizzcon was to get some feedback and see what might need to be adjusted.” “We can’t give a percentage, but this is still a work in progress,’ Sousa said. The only complaints that fans had were directed at the mishmashed art style that came from a mix of newly redesigned HD character models and the lack of lighting and details in the old environments. “There will be exceptions on which custom game we can bring back, but a lot will be coming.” “Reforged will have the same world editor as the original, with new improvements,” lead artist Brian Sousa said. Blizzard has also confirmed that Reign of Chaos, as well as the expansion, The Frozen Throne will be included - making the game a complete package.
